Review: Teksta Scorpion

The boys loved the latest range in robot toys that are around. We’ve tried out the puppy and T-rex but they LOVE the lastest! Probably because they know there is no way that they will be allowed real one ever…A scorpion!

In the box which RRPS at £40 you get a Teksta Scorpion, a target and a tilt sensor robot control which attaches to the back of your hand. It does require a lot of batteries though which are included so do make sure you buy! You need 4xAA which runs the Scorpion and 2xAAA for the controller. Its aimed at 5yrs plus.

The RC attaches to your hand and you can control the Scorpion to move forward and back and left and right and make it stop.  You can also meet up with your friends to go into battle. Up to 5 robots at a time. All the legs move to give a great effect (no gliding on wheels!) and it uses a great jaw action to snap at objects including the one which comes in the box. When you’re ready to go the eyes light up and you can let battle commence!

The boys enjoyed it and cant wait for their friend to get one so they can meet up and battle but there are a couple of irks which I hope they sort out soon. One we’d set the frequency the first time we didn’t realise that we had to redo it every time we switched it on. Also we found a couple of times a leg came off but we’ve found this with other Teksta products. It’s easier enough to click back on but with two boys in the house it happens more than I like!



The remote can be used either by being held in your hand or by being strapped on the back. Needless to say one child prefers it one way the other the opposite! The movements though were pretty spot on. I would recommend playing it on a hard surface though rather than carpet as it lagged a lot on ours and the boys found it frustrating. However in the kitchen it went pretty fast much to the dog and cats dislike!

I think this is a great addition from the Teksta team as though its aimed at 5+ it appeals far more than the puppy and kittens to teenagers and they ones we’ve had round playing for it love the fact it battles other scorpions and you can get quite a few playing at once.
